perf annotate: Introduce the --stdio2 output mode

This uses the TUI augmented formatting routines, modulo interactivity.

  # perf annotate --ignore-vmlinux --stdio2 _raw_spin_lock_irqsave
  _raw_spin_lock_irqsave() /proc/kcore
  Event: cycles:ppp

  Percent

              Disassembly of section load0:

              ffffffff9a8734b0 <load0>:
                nop
                push   %rbx
   50.00        pushfq
                pop    %rax
                nop
                mov    %rax,%rbx
                cli
                nop
                xor    %eax,%eax
                mov    $0x1,%edx
   50.00        lock   cmpxchg %edx,(%rdi)
                test   %eax,%eax
              ↓ jne    2b
                mov    %rbx,%rax
                pop    %rbx
              ← retq
          2b:   mov    %eax,%esi
              → callq  queued_spin_lock_slowpath
                mov    %rbx,%rax
                pop    %rbx
              ← retq
